The Symantec Endpoint Protection client weekly scheduled scan actions for when a Security Risk has been detected must be configured to Delete risk as first action.

Description
Malware may have infected a file that is necessary to the user. By configuring the antivirus software to first attempt cleaning the infected file, availability to the file is not sacrificed. If a cleaning attempt is not successful, however, deleting the file is the only safe option to ensure the malware does is not introduced onto the system or network.

Check Text ( C-49074r3_chk )
GUI check: Locate the Symantec Endpoint Protection icon in the system tray. Double-click the icon to open the Symantec Endpoint Protection configuration screen. On the left hand side, select Scan for Threats -> Double-click the applied policy -> Select Actions -> Select Security Risk -> Ensure first action is set to "Delete Risk".

Criteria: If first action is not set to "Delete Risk", this is a finding.

On the machine use the Windows Registry Editor to navigate to the following key:
32 bit:
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\AV\LocalScans\{scan ID}\Expanded
64 bit:
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\AV\LocalScans\{scan ID}\Expanded

Criteria: If the value of "FirstAction" is not 3, this is a finding.
Fix Text (F-48388r1_fix)
Locate the Symantec Endpoint Protection icon in the system tray. Double-click the icon to open the Symantec Endpoint Protection configuration screen. On the left hand side, select Scan for Threats -> Double-click the applied policy -> Select Actions -> Select Security Risk -> Set first action to "Delete Risk".
